How much are Golf Clubs Worth at a Pawn Shop

The value of golf clubs at a pawn shop will depend on several factors such as the brand, condition, age, and model of the clubs.

Generally, premium golf club brands such as Titleist, Ping, TaylorMade, and Callaway will fetch higher prices at pawn shops compared to lesser-known brands. Clubs that are in excellent condition with minimal wear and tear will also have a higher value.

On the other hand, older models of clubs may not be as valuable as newer ones, and clubs that have significant damage or are missing components may have a lower value or not be accepted for sale at all.

It’s also important to keep in mind that pawn shops typically offer lower prices for items than what they would be sold for in a retail setting. This is because pawn shops need to make a profit when reselling the items they buy from customers.

To get a better idea of how much your golf clubs might be worth at a pawn shop, you can start by checking online retailers and golf stores to see how much similar clubs are selling for new. This will give you an idea of the original retail price and how much the clubs might have depreciated in value over time.

Next, you can search online marketplaces or auction sites to see how much similar clubs are selling for in the used market. This can give you an idea of what kind of prices you might be able to expect at a pawn shop.

It’s also a good idea to bring any documentation you have for the clubs, such as original receipts or proof of purchase, as this can help establish their authenticity and value.

When bringing your clubs to a pawn shop for appraisal, be prepared to negotiate on the price. Pawn shops will often offer a lower price initially, but you can try to negotiate for a higher price if you feel your clubs are worth more.

Overall, the value of golf clubs at a pawn shop can vary widely, so it’s important to do your research and be prepared to negotiate to get the best price possible.
